Hello,
I am new to this forum and have a query. What about the country to which an FSP officer is posted? Does it depend on merit among the FSP officers or is it completely up to the ministry? Waiting for reply. Thanks

1st posting totally depends on your merit. Afterwards, it is your calibre and performance. If you are good in your job, you will remain at good stations like EU or Americas.
It is the only top group in CSS where postings are not political till grade 20 since politicians have no interest in FSP. So go for FSP and dont waste your life in PAS/PSP etc.
